Proxy Saving and UX Fixes (#4467)

This commit is contained in:
Marc Kelechava
2026-01-15 13:26:26 -08:00
committed by GitHub
parent 5e23c580e7
commit be3128e47d
6 changed files with 21 additions and 7 deletions

View File

@@ -116,7 +116,7 @@ function compareWorkflowBlocks(
function getWorkflowElements(version: WorkflowVersion) {
const settings: WorkflowSettings = {
proxyLocation: version.proxy_location || ProxyLocation.Residential,
proxyLocation: version.proxy_location ?? ProxyLocation.Residential,
webhookCallbackUrl: version.webhook_callback_url || "",
persistBrowserSession: version.persist_browser_session,
model: version.model,

View File

@@ -956,7 +956,7 @@ function Workspace({
// Load the selected version into the main editor
const settings: WorkflowSettings = {
proxyLocation:
selectedVersion.proxy_location || ProxyLocation.Residential,
selectedVersion.proxy_location ?? ProxyLocation.Residential,
webhookCallbackUrl: selectedVersion.webhook_callback_url || "",
persistBrowserSession: selectedVersion.persist_browser_session,
model: selectedVersion.model,
@@ -1660,7 +1660,7 @@ function Workspace({
const settings: WorkflowSettings = {
proxyLocation:
saveData?.settings.proxyLocation || ProxyLocation.Residential,
saveData?.settings.proxyLocation ?? ProxyLocation.Residential,
webhookCallbackUrl: saveData?.settings.webhookCallbackUrl || "",
persistBrowserSession:
saveData?.settings.persistBrowserSession ?? false,

View File

@@ -141,7 +141,7 @@ function compareWorkflowBlocks(
function getWorkflowElements(version: WorkflowVersion) {
const settings: WorkflowSettings = {
proxyLocation: version.proxy_location || ProxyLocation.Residential,
proxyLocation: version.proxy_location ?? ProxyLocation.Residential,
webhookCallbackUrl: version.webhook_callback_url || "",
persistBrowserSession: version.persist_browser_session,
model: version.model,